|
@@ -58,17 +58,17 @@
|
|
|
<div class="height_100">
|
|
|
<table class="PatentMessage">
|
|
|
<tr>
|
|
|
- <td>公告号</td>
|
|
|
+ <td><p style="min-width:120px">公告号</p> </td>
|
|
|
<td> <span v-if="patent">{{ patent.grantNo }}</span></td>
|
|
|
- <td>公告日</td>
|
|
|
+ <td><p style="min-width:120px">公告日</p> </td>
|
|
|
<td><span v-if="patent">{{ patent.grantDate }}</span></td>
|
|
|
- <td>专利权人</td>
|
|
|
+ <td><p style="min-width:120px">专利权人</p> </td>
|
|
|
<td><span v-if="patent && patent.rightHolder">
|
|
|
<span v-for="item in patent.rightHolder.filter(a => a.type == 1)" :key="item.name">{{ item.name }}</span></span></td>
|
|
|
</tr>
|
|
|
<tr>
|
|
|
<td>优先权</td>
|
|
|
- <td><span v-if="patent">{{ patent.priorityNo }}</span></td>
|
|
|
+ <td><span v-if="patent && patent.priorities && patent.priorities.length>0">{{ patent.priorities[0].priorityno }}</span></td>
|
|
|
<td>案件状态</td>
|
|
|
<td> <span v-if="patent && patent.simpleStatusStr">{{ patent.simpleStatusStr }}</span></td>
|
|
|
<td>同族专利</td>
|
|
@@ -269,8 +269,8 @@ export default {
|
|
|
methods: {
|
|
|
// 处理同族专利
|
|
|
getPatentFamily(list) {
|
|
|
- if (list.InpadocFamilyNos) {
|
|
|
- return list.InpadocFamilyNos.join(',')
|
|
|
+ if (list.inpadocFamilyNos) {
|
|
|
+ return list.inpadocFamilyNos.join(',')
|
|
|
} else {
|
|
|
return ''
|
|
|
}
|
|
@@ -341,7 +341,11 @@ export default {
|
|
|
projectId: this.projectId,
|
|
|
patentNo: patentNo,
|
|
|
}
|
|
|
- this.$api.getLastRecord(params).then(res => {
|
|
|
+ var api = 'getLastRecord'
|
|
|
+ if(this.reportType == 4){
|
|
|
+ api = 'getTortFinalResult'
|
|
|
+ }
|
|
|
+ this.$api[api](params).then(res => {
|
|
|
if (res.code == 200) {
|
|
|
// this.tableData = res.data
|
|
|
this.getInterface(res)
|